A solar BESS system integrates solar panels with a battery energy storage unit to capture excess solar power generated during the day and discharge it when sunlight is unavailable or electricity demand peaks. They enhance grid stability, reduce energy costs, and provide backup power during outages. For engineers working in power distribution. .
